Description

2-(3,5-Difluorophenyl)Pyrimidine-5-Carbaldehyde is a high-purity fluorinated pyrimidine derivative, a key building block in advanced organic synthesis. Its value lies in its precise molecular architecture, which is critical for constructing complex molecules with specific electronic and steric properties. This compound is primarily needed by R&D chemists and process development scientists in the pharmaceutical and agrochemical industries for the development of new active ingredients.

Application

  • Pharmaceutical Intermediate: A crucial precursor in the synthesis of novel small-molecule drug candidates, particularly kinase inhibitors and other targeted therapies.
  • Agrochemical Research: Used in the development of new herbicides, fungicides, and insecticides, leveraging the bioactivity of the difluorophenyl-pyrimidine scaffold.
  • Material Science: Serves as a monomer or functionalizing agent in the creation of specialty polymers and organic electronic materials.
  • Chemical Synthesis: Acts as a versatile aldehyde component in cross-coupling reactions, condensations, and reductive amination for library synthesis.
  • Ligand & Catalyst Development: Employed in the design and synthesis of novel ligands for catalysis and metal-organic frameworks (MOFs).

Basic Information

Product Name 2-(3,5-Difluorophenyl)Pyrimidine-5-Carbaldehyde
CAS No. 960198-48-5
Molecular Formula C11H6F2N2O
Molecular Weight 220.18 g/mol
Synonyms 5-Formyl-2-(3,5-difluorophenyl)pyrimidine; 2-(3,5-Difluorophenyl)-5-pyrimidinecarboxaldehyde; 2-(3,5-Difluorophenyl)pyrimidine-5-carboxaldehyde; 960198-48-5; 5-Pyrimidinecarboxaldehyde, 2-(3,5-difluorophenyl)-; 2-(3,5-Difluorophenyl)-5-formylpyrimidine

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at room temperature (15-25°C). This material is light-sensitive and should be handled and stored accordingly to maintain stability.

Specification

Item Specification
Appearance White to off-white crystalline powder
Identification (IR) Conforms to structure
Identification (HPLC) Conforms to reference standard
Purity (HPLC) ≥ 97.0%
Water Content (KF) ≤ 0.5%
Residue on Ignition ≤ 0.1%
